How ZIP 19958 in Lewes, DE has changed in 5 years
Household income in the area moved from $78,449 to $97,197 across the same window, up 23.9% versus 2021. The population has grown by 14.3% since 2021, moving from about 27,944 residents to roughly 31,938. College-educated residents now make up 50.1% of adults here, versus 45.8% in 2021.

ZIP code 19958 covers Lewes, DE. The median rent here is $2,240/mo as of July 2026. A 1-bedroom rents for a median of $1,410/mo. A 2-bedroom rents for a median of $1,850/mo.
At 28% of local median household income ($97,197/yr), ZIP 19958 ranks as affordable compared to the national benchmark of 30%. Rents have decreased 3.0% over the past year.
